Why Clipboard Health Exists:

We exist to lift as many people up the socioeconomic ladder as possible. We dramatically improve lives by letting healthcare professionals turn extra time and ambition into career growth and financial opportunity. We achieve this with our app-based marketplace that connects healthcare facilities and healthcare professionals, allowing professionals to book on-demand shifts and facilities to access on-demand talent.

About Clipboard Health:

Clipboard Health is a fast-growing Series C marketplace. We are a leader in our Long Term Care vertical and are expanding into several others (Dental Offices, Schools, etc).
We are a YC Top Company with a global, remote team of 600+ people. We have been profitable since 2022, and fill millions of shifts annually at partner workplaces across the US, where tens of thousands of professionals work with us every year.

We’re hiring a Documents Team Lead to manage a team of agents who handle escalated documentation issues, fraud prevention, and onboarding quality for professionals using the Clipboard Health platform. As the Team Lead, you’ll be responsible for agent performance, quality control, queue management, and cross-functional alignment. You’ll coach SMEs to apply good judgment, ensure documentation standards are followed, and help maintain trust and safety at scale.

What You’ll Own

Team Leadership & Performance Management

  • Manage a team of Tier 1 agents who review documentation and support onboarding workflows
  • Set expectations around speed, accuracy, and decision quality and ensure those expectations are met.
  • Run regular 1:1s, track metrics (TAT, QA, error rates), and lead performance reviews.
  • Coach SMEs on risk evaluation, written communication, and cross-functional collaboration.

Queue Oversight & Operational Execution

  • Monitor and manage daily document queues, unread case resolution, and onboarding document tasks.
  • Step in to support agents with complex or ambiguous submissions as needed.
  • Balance the team’s workload across shifts and ensure SLAs are consistently met across time zones.

Quality & Risk Management

  • Ensure document approvals are consistent, complete, and policy-aligned.
  • Track common error patterns, escalate systemic issues, and implement improvements.
  • Collaborate with QA and Legal teams to uphold trust and compliance standards.

Cross-Functional Coordination

  • Act as the primary liaison between your team and functions like Sales, Support, Product, and Legal.
  • Triage and resolve document-related issues that block onboarding or raise compliance questions.
  • Represent your team in weekly operational syncs and drive alignment with broader workflows.

Training & Continuous Improvement

  • Onboard and ramp new Tier 1 agents quickly and confidently.
  • Provide hands-on coaching to help agents navigate complex cases or unclear documentation.
  • Identify recurring workflow issues and partner with internal teams to address root causes.

What We’re Looking For

  • Experience managing or coaching frontline agents (e.g., in document review, support, or compliance).
  • Strong operational instincts, you know how to manage queues, meet SLAs, and respond to changing needs.
  • Excellent written communication and feedback skills.
  • Confidence working in gray areas and helping others build judgment.
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
  • Bonus: Experience in credentialing, healthcare operations, compliance, or trust & safety.

Why This Role Matters

Every shift on our platform starts with someone being approved to book. If we get documentation wrong, if we miss a fraud risk, approve the wrong license, or delay onboarding we put customers, patients, and our business at risk. Your team makes sure that doesn’t happen. You’ll be a manager dedicated to this function, helping us scale a high-trust document review process that protects our platform and enables healthcare professionals to start work with speed and confidence.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
